Can someone please help me before I go mental!!!I am trying to remove the oil pressure relief valve from my Astra (Ecotec C18XEL). I've managed to get the plug, washer and spring out but the piston is stuck fast. Any ideas how I can get the bugger out? I've tried to hook it out as suggested elsewhere but still no go.Anyone? :oops:

Last resort this : You need an ark welder, touch tip of welding rod onto stuck plunger so that it fuses to it, then quickly turn welder off. Remove rod holder and yank on welding rod with pliers. Be careful though, SMALL rod, LOW amps.
